Command-Column-Implementation: Difference between revisions
Jump to navigation
Jump to search
Embeddedrf (talk | contribs) |
Embeddedrf (talk | contribs) No edit summary |
||
| (2 intermediate revisions by the same user not shown) | |||
| Line 13: | Line 13: | ||
== Controller Driver Notes == | |||
== Controller Driver Notes - Writing output state == | |||
*in order to use more than one output you must read and mask off the output bit register to prevent changing other bits | |||
[[Image:Controller-Register-Constants.jpg]] | [[Image:Controller-Register-Constants.jpg]] | ||
| Line 22: | Line 26: | ||
[[Image:Anafaze-Output-MemoryMap.jpg]] | [[Image:Anafaze-Output-MemoryMap.jpg]] | ||
*The address of the digital I/O registers | |||
<br><br> | <br><br> | ||
[[Image:Anafaze-Driver-Outputs.jpg]] | [[Image:Anafaze-Driver-Outputs.jpg]] | ||
== References == | == References == | ||
Latest revision as of 18:11, 24 December 2008
Command Column Design Constraints[edit]
- limitation = 20 characters length column length
Possibilities[edit]
- 1- auxiliary digit I/O outputs 1's | 0's ... quantity=7 - triggered at the beginning of the design profile segment
- 2- a file name -
- 3- command strings - make an extensible interface. Allow messages to be sent in & out.
Controller Driver Notes - Writing output state[edit]
- in order to use more than one output you must read and mask off the output bit register to prevent changing other bits
- MAXDIGOUT - is a constant = 35 so I assume the unused are available for digital I/O
- The address of the digital I/O registers


